Chocolate Chip Oat Raisin Cookies

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:12 mins
Total Time:27 mins
Servings: 24

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ter
  • 0.75 cup brown sugar
  • 0.5 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1.5 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 3 cups rolled oats
  • 1 cup raisins
  • 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, cream together the unsalted but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y, about 2-3 minutes.

Step 3

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Mix in the vanilla extract.

Step 4

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, ground cinnamon, and salt.

Step 5

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.

Step 6

Gently fold in the rolled oats, raisins, and semisweet chocolate chips until evenly distributed.

Step 7

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to the prepared baking sheets, leaving about 2 inches between each cookie.

Step 8

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den but the centers are still soft.

Step 9

Remove the cookies from the oven and let them c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 10

Serve and enjoy your Chocolate Chip Oat Raisin Cookies with a glass of milk or your favorite hot drink!
